The Heart of Worcestershire College and specialist education provider National Star's joint programme in Worcester aims to support young people in preparing for independent living. "By working together with National Star, we’ve been able to offer young adults in Worcestershire access to specialist education and support closer to home, giving them greater choice, confidence, and the skills they need to thrive in adulthood. "We’ve created a provision that not only empowers learners but also delivers real impact for families across Worcestershire." Previously, many post-16 learners in Worcestershire had to travel to National Star’s Gloucestershire campus to access the specialist education and therapy outlined in their Education, Health, and Care Plans (EHCPs). Lynette Barrett, chief executive of National Star, said: "Putting the needs of students and their families at the heart of this unique partnership is what has made it the success that it is today.
